 | class RtpRtcpObserver { | 
 |  public: | 
 |   enum Action { | 
 |     SEND_PACKET, | 
 |     DROP_PACKET, | 
 |   }; | 
 |  | 
 |   virtual ~RtpRtcpObserver() {} | 
 |  | 
 |   virtual bool Wait() { | 
 |     if (field_trial::IsEnabled("WebRTC-QuickPerfTest")) { | 
 |       observation_complete_.Wait(kShortTimeoutMs); | 
 |       return true; | 
 |     } | 
 |     return observation_complete_.Wait(timeout_ms_); | 
 |   } | 
 |  | 
 |   virtual Action OnSendRtp(const uint8_t* packet, size_t length) { | 
 |     return SEND_PACKET; | 
 |   } | 
 |  | 
 |   virtual Action OnSendRtcp(const uint8_t* packet, size_t length) { | 
 |     return SEND_PACKET; | 
 |   } | 
 |  | 
 |   virtual Action OnReceiveRtp(const uint8_t* packet, size_t length) { | 
 |     return SEND_PACKET; | 
 |   } | 
 |  | 
 |   virtual Action OnReceiveRtcp(const uint8_t* packet, size_t length) { | 
 |     return SEND_PACKET; | 
 |   } | 
 |  | 
 |  protected: | 
 |   RtpRtcpObserver() : RtpRtcpObserver(0) {} | 
 |   explicit RtpRtcpObserver(int event_timeout_ms) | 
 |       : observation_complete_(false, false), | 
 |         parser_(RtpHeaderParser::Create()), | 
 |         timeout_ms_(event_timeout_ms) { | 
 |     parser_->RegisterRtpHeaderExtension(kRtpExtensionTransmissionTimeOffset, | 
 |                                         kTOffsetExtensionId); | 
 |     parser_->RegisterRtpHeaderExtension(kRtpExtensionAbsoluteSendTime, | 
 |                                         kAbsSendTimeExtensionId); | 
 |     parser_->RegisterRtpHeaderExtension(kRtpExtensionTransportSequenceNumber, | 
 |                                         kTransportSequenceNumberExtensionId); | 
 |   } | 
 |  | 
 |   rtc::Event observation_complete_; | 
 |   const std::unique_ptr<RtpHeaderParser> parser_; | 
 |  | 
 |  private: | 
 |   const int timeout_ms_; | 
 | }; | 
 |  | 
 | class PacketTransport : public test::DirectTransport { | 
 |  public: | 
 |   enum TransportType { kReceiver, kSender }; | 
 |  | 
 |   PacketTransport(SingleThreadedTaskQueueForTesting* task_queue, | 
 |                   Call* send_call, | 
 |                   RtpRtcpObserver* observer, | 
 |                   TransportType transport_type, | 
 |                   const std::map<uint8_t, MediaType>& payload_type_map, | 
 |                   const FakeNetworkPipe::Config& configuration) | 
 |       : test::DirectTransport(task_queue, | 
 |                               configuration, | 
 |                               send_call, | 
 |                               payload_type_map), | 
 |         observer_(observer), | 
 |         transport_type_(transport_type) {} | 
 |  | 
 |  private: | 
 |   bool SendRtp(const uint8_t* packet, | 
 |                size_t length, | 
 |                const PacketOptions& options) override { | 
 |     EXPECT_FALSE(RtpHeaderParser::IsRtcp(packet, length)); | 
 |     RtpRtcpObserver::Action action; | 
 |     { | 
 |       if (transport_type_ == kSender) { | 
 |         action = observer_->OnSendRtp(packet, length); | 
 |       } else { | 
 |         action = observer_->OnReceiveRtp(packet, length); | 
 |       } | 
 |     } | 
 |     switch (action) { | 
 |       case RtpRtcpObserver::DROP_PACKET: | 
 |         // Drop packet silently. | 
 |         return true; | 
 |       case RtpRtcpObserver::SEND_PACKET: | 
 |         return test::DirectTransport::SendRtp(packet, length, options); | 
 |     } | 
 |     return true;  // Will never happen, makes compiler happy. | 
 |   } | 
 |  | 
 |   bool SendRtcp(const uint8_t* packet, size_t length) override { | 
 |     EXPECT_TRUE(RtpHeaderParser::IsRtcp(packet, length)); | 
 |     RtpRtcpObserver::Action action; | 
 |     { | 
 |       if (transport_type_ == kSender) { | 
 |         action = observer_->OnSendRtcp(packet, length); | 
 |       } else { | 
 |         action = observer_->OnReceiveRtcp(packet, length); | 
 |       } | 
 |     } | 
 |     switch (action) { | 
 |       case RtpRtcpObserver::DROP_PACKET: | 
 |         // Drop packet silently. | 
 |         return true; | 
 |       case RtpRtcpObserver::SEND_PACKET: | 
 |         return test::DirectTransport::SendRtcp(packet, length); | 
 |     } | 
 |     return true;  // Will never happen, makes compiler happy. | 
 |   } | 
 |  | 
 |   RtpRtcpObserver* const observer_; | 
 |   TransportType transport_type_; | 
 | }; |
